For the first time in the country, the Seoul Metropolitan Government has announced the first comprehensive measures, ranging from loneliness prevention to seclusion and isolation, and has decided to invest 451.3 billion won over five years.


Seoul Mayor Oh Se-hoon stressed that loneliness and isolation are tasks that society must solve together, and that he will mobilize all of his administrative capabilities and manage everything from prevention to healing, returning to society and preventing re-establishment for "Lonely Seoul."The city of

decided to first operate a call center dedicated to loneliness 24 hours a day from April next year, and to test-run four "Seoul Mind Convenience Stores" next year, where anyone can comfortably visit and communicate while enjoying Seoul Ramen.

{ 안녕}'Goodbye to Loneliness 120' counseling and convenience stores will also place citizens who have escaped from isolation and seclusion as counselors.

In addition, it announced that it will expand a health meal table for middle-aged and single-person households and a health longevity center for the elderly.For reclusive citizens in

, a 'constant discovery system' will be operated by linking crisis information such as gas and electricity with various administrative information and customized prescriptions according to the life cycle.

In particular, the plan is to create a notification window that allows you to identify your own risk of isolation in cooperation with the delivery app platform, and to lead outside activities by providing discount coupons when visiting restaurants.The city of

announced that it will expand open spaces such as green spaces during development and maintenance to actively secure natural healing and exchange spaces in the city center, and increase daily vitality by providing benefits for outdoor activities such as participation in festivals or outings through the 365 Seoul Challenge.
